  • Today we're discussing a few controversial topics, starting with a Pride flag spotted on the set of "The Chosen," a popular TV series focusing on the life of Jesus. The flag was seen attached to camera equipment in a promotional clip and belongs to a crew member, which naturally drew a lot of negative feedback. We take a look at whether this is cause for concern and what's realistic to expect from "Christian" shows. Then we move over to Florida, where an Orlando-based convention for furries (people who enjoy dressing up as anthropomorphized creatures) announced it would ban children due to a Florida Senate bill that makes exposing children to sexual performances illegal. We discuss why this move reveals a lot about the "furry" community. Then we're joined by Florida Representative Jessica Baker, who sponsored a Florida bill that allows sexual battery against a child under 12 years old to be considered a capital offense, punishable by the death penalty. She explains why this bill is important to her and why it's essential that we punish child abuse justly.
